CMC to shift private bus stand in before Dasara

CMC President Kaveramma Somanna said that the private bus stand will be shifted to the newly built private bus stand near Race Course Road before Dasara. The final decision on the same will be taken within 15 days.

Speaking to reporters on Wednesday, she said that she is confident of the private bus owners and drivers agreeing to the shifting.

There are allegations of poor quality of work. An amount of Rs 20 lakh is yet to be paid to the contractor. If there is any substandard work, the contractor will be paid only after the quality assurance, she clarified.

She said the private bus stand has been constructed by taking three acres of land belonging to the Horticultural Department. Initially, Basanth Consultancy was asked to prepare a DPR.

The DPR with bus terminal, concrete road, commercial complex and hotel was prepared at a cost of Rs 19.37 crore. Later, it was decided to construct the necessary infrastructure on PPP mode, which failed to get approval from the government.

Finally, the bus stand was constructed with the grants released by the government. As Rs 19 crore grant was not available, the estimate was reduced to Rs 4.99 crore.

According to the DPR, only bus terminal and other necessary works were taken up. While laying the foundation, groundwater was available. Realising the possible threat to the building, experts from Sullia inspected the land. Engineers were asked to fill the land with sand and stones. Based on the soil test report, the building was constructed. An additional quantity of iron was used in the construction. Hence, the expenditure escalated, she clarified.

The opposition is levelling allegations on substandard work. The bills for the work were cleared in a phased manner. There was a third party inspection of the building, she added.

In-charge commissioner Gopalakrishna said the bus service will commence after prohibiting the parking of vehicles on the industrial area.
